Disability shower installation services involve modifying or constructing showers to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These installations typically include features such as low-threshold or curbless entryways,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ring to enhance safety and accessibility. The goal is to create a bathroom environment that allows for easier and safer use, especially for those with limited mobility, balance issues, or other physical limitations. Skilled contractors work to ensure that the shower setup complies with ergonomic standards and provides convenient access for users with diverse needs.
This service addresses common problems faced by individuals who struggle with traditional shower designs. Many standard showers present barriers such as high thresholds, slippery surfaces, or lack of support features, increasing the risk of slips, falls, and injuries. Installing a disability-friendly shower can significantly reduce these hazards, fostering independence and confidence in personal hygiene routines. Additionally, these modifications can alleviate the need for assistance, making daily activities more manageable for users and their caregivers.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the complexity of the project. Basic installations near Natick, MA, may be closer to the lower end, while custom features increase expenses.
Materials & Fixtures - The price for shower fixtures and accessible materials can vary from $300 to $1,200. High-end or specialized fixtures tend to be more expensive, influencing the overall cost.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for professional installation generally fall between $500 and $2,000, depending on the scope of work and local contractor rates. Larger or more complex installations may require additional labor hours.
Total Project Cost - Overall costs for disability shower installation services typically range from $2,300 to $7,000, with factors like site conditions and customization affecting the final price. Contact local provid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
